Grandfamily Housing Act of 2023

The Grandfamily Housing Act of 2023 establishes a federal grant program for owners of intergenerational housing units - homes where grandparents or other relatives live with grandchildren. Grants cover costs for service coordinators to provide onsite support (like tutoring, healthcare, and after-school care), community outreach, and property modifications to support these families. The program requires coordination with local kinship navigator programs and mandates a report to Congress on the program's effectiveness within two years. It directly affects property owners in qualifying intergenerational housing units and aims to strengthen support services for these families through HUD-administered grants.
